22 #pragma prototyped
23 
24 #include <ast.h>
25 
26 #if _lib_execve
27 
28 NoN(execve)
29 
30 #else
31 
32 #include <sig.h>
33 #include <wait.h>
34 #include <error.h>
35 
36 static pid_t		childpid;
37 
38 static void
39 execsig(int sig)
40 {
41 	kill(childpid, sig);
42 	signal(sig, execsig);
43 }
44 
45 #if defined(__EXPORT__)
46 #define extern	__EXPORT__
47 #endif
48 
49 extern int
50 execve(const char* path, char* const argv[], char* const arge[])
51 {
52 	int	status;
53 
54 	if ((childpid = spawnve(path, argv, arge)) < 0)
55 		return(-1);
56 	for (status = 0; status < 64; status++)
57 		signal(status, execsig);
58 	while (waitpid(childpid, &status, 0) == -1)
59 		if (errno != EINTR) return(-1);
60 	if (WIFSIGNALED(status))
61 	{
62 		signal(WTERMSIG(status), SIG_DFL);
63 		kill(getpid(), WTERMSIG(status));
64 		pause();
65 	}
66 	else status = WEXITSTATUS(status);
67 	exit(status);
68 }
69 
70 #endif
